Barbecue Sauce
soups-sauces SR Legacy · per 100g
Barbecue Sauce provides 172 kcal per 100g, with 0.8 g protein, 0.6 g fat, and 40.8 g carbohydrates. It is a notable source of Iron (0.640 mg, 8% RDA), Copper (0.072 mg, 8% RDA), Potassium (232 mg, 7% RDA), Vitamin B6 (0.075 mg, 6% RDA), Manganese (0.126 mg, 5% RDA), Vitamin E (0.800 mg, 5% RDA), and Riboflavin (B2) (0.056 mg, 4% RDA). Nutrient data from USDA FoodData Central (SR Legacy dataset), per 100g edible portion.

Detailed Nutrition
Per
USDA/NIH DRI · National Academies
| Nutrient | Amount | Unit | % RDA |
|---|---|---|---|
| Energy | 172.0 | kcal | — |
| Protein | 0.820 | g | 1% |
| Total Fat | 0.630 | g | — |
| Carbohydrate | 40.8 | g | 31% |
| Water | 54.7 | g | — |
| Nutrient | Amount | Unit | % RDA |
|---|---|---|---|
| Vitamin C | 0.600 | mg | 1% |
| Thiamin (B1) | 0.023 | mg | 2% |
| Riboflavin (B2) | 0.056 | mg | 4% |
| Niacin (B3) | 0.597 | mg | 4% |
| Pantothenic Acid (B5) | 0.164 | mg | 3% |
| Vitamin B6 | 0.075 | mg | 6% |
| Folate (DFE) | 2.0 | mcg | 1% |
| Choline | 7.1 | mg | 1% |
| Vitamin A (RAE) | 11.0 | mcg | 1% |
| Vitamin E | 0.800 | mg | 5% |
| Vitamin K | 1.8 | mcg | 2% |
